package com.github.cbpos1989.gui_tutorials;
import java.awt.Color;
import java.awt.Graphics;
import javax.swing.JPanel;
/**
* Implement the GUI components and painting methods for SimplePaintApp.
*
* @author Colm O'Sullivan
*
*/
public class SimplePaintPanel extends JPanel {
/**
*
*/
private static final long serialVersionUID = 1L;
private final static int BLACK = 0,
RED = 1,
GREEN = 2,
BLUE = 3,
CYAN = 4,
MAGENTA = 5,
YELLOW = 6;
private int currentColor = BLACK;
protected Graphics graphicsForDrawing;
private SimplePaintHandler listener;
public SimplePaintPanel(){
this.listener = new SimplePaintHandler(this);
setBackground(Color.WHITE);
addMouseListener(listener);
addMouseMotionListener(listener);
}
public void paintComponent(Graphics g){
super.paintComponent(g);
int width = getWidth();
int height = getHeight();
int colorSpacing = (height -56)/7;
//Drawing 3-pixel border around panel
g.setColor(Color.GRAY);
g.drawRect(0, 0, width - 1, height - 1);
g.drawRect(1, 1, width - 3, height - 3);
g.drawRect(2, 2, width - 5, height - 5);
//Drawing the right hand panel for the colour palettes
g.fillRect(width - 56 , 0, 56, height);
//Drawing the clear button
g.setColor(Color.WHITE);
g.fillRect(width - 53, height - 53, 50, 50);
g.setColor(Color.BLACK);
g.drawRect(width - 53, height - 53, 49, 49);
g.drawString("CLEAR", width -48, height -23);
//Drawing the seven colour palettes
g.setColor(Color.BLACK);
g.fillRect(width - 53, 3 + 0*colorSpacing, 50, colorSpacing -3);
g.setColor(Color.RED);
g.fillRect(width - 53, 3 + 1*colorSpacing, 50, colorSpacing -3);
g.setColor(Color.GREEN);
g.fillRect(width - 53, 3 + 2*colorSpacing, 50, colorSpacing -3);
g.setColor(Color.BLUE);
g.fillRect(width - 53, 3 + 3*colorSpacing, 50, colorSpacing -3);
g.setColor(Color.CYAN);
g.fillRect(width - 53, 3 + 4*colorSpacing, 50, colorSpacing -3);
g.setColor(Color.MAGENTA);
g.fillRect(width - 53, 3 + 5*colorSpacing, 50, colorSpacing -3);
g.setColor(Color.YELLOW);
g.fillRect(width - 53, 3 + 6*colorSpacing, 50, colorSpacing -3);
//Draw white border around currently selected color.
g.setColor(Color.WHITE);
g.drawRect(width - 55, 1 + currentColor*colorSpacing, 53, colorSpacing);
g.drawRect(width - 54, 2 + currentColor*colorSpacing, 51, colorSpacing - 2);
}
//Change the color depending on what color palate the user clicks on.
void changeColor(int y){
int width = getWidth();
int height = getHeight();
int colorSpacing = (height - 56)/7;
int newColor = y / colorSpacing;
if(newColor < 0 || newColor > 6){
return;
}
Graphics g = getGraphics();
g.setColor(Color.GRAY);
g.drawRect(width -55, 1 + currentColor*colorSpacing, 53, colorSpacing);
g.drawRect(width -54, 2 + currentColor*colorSpacing, 51, colorSpacing -2);
currentColor = newColor;
g.setColor(Color.WHITE);
g.drawRect(width -55, 1 + currentColor*colorSpacing, 53, colorSpacing);
g.drawRect(width -54, 2 + currentColor*colorSpacing, 51, colorSpacing -2);
g.dispose();
}
void setUpDrawingGraphics(){
graphicsForDrawing = getGraphics();
switch(currentColor){
case BLACK:
graphicsForDrawing.setColor(Color.BLACK);
break;
case RED:
graphicsForDrawing.setColor(Color.RED);
break;
case GREEN:
graphicsForDrawing.setColor(Color.GREEN);
break;
case BLUE:
graphicsForDrawing.setColor(Color.BLUE);
break;
case CYAN:
graphicsForDrawing.setColor(Color.CYAN);
break;
case MAGENTA:
graphicsForDrawing.setColor(Color.MAGENTA);
break;
case YELLOW:
graphicsForDrawing.setColor(Color.YELLOW);
break;
}
}
}
